As sophisticated as the autonomous drone is or could be, it is still basically a highly automated boobytrap. Just like a landmine that in its most basic form asserts a quasi military doctrine over a small postage stamp size patch of land (step here and get blown to smithereens), the highly automated boobytrap would in theory analyze behavior and movement patterns through any number of more sophisticated methods than a spring and tripwire, but the concept is the same, a tripwire event takes place, the machine takes hostile action.

It always seems to be the dumb ones that are the most dangerous and unpredictable and boobytrap warfare is always and will always will be intelligence information driven.
